Milwaukee 5/32" x 2" x 4" SHOCKWAVE Impact Duty Carbide Hammer Drill Bit

5/32" x 2" x 4" SHOCKWAVE Impact Duty Carbide Hammer Drill Bit

Features

  • Robust carbide for extended life in concrete
  • Precision ground carbide tip for increased drilling speed
  • Built-in 1/4" hex shoulder for use in concrete screw installation
  • 5/32" drill bit suitable for 3/16" concrete screws
  • Sharpened carbide edges to minimize bit walking
  • Engineered for use with hammer drills and impacts
  • Wide flute design for effective dust removal

Design and Build Quality

The first thing that stands out about this Milwaukee drill bit is its construction. The bit features a carbide tip, which is known for its hardness and wear resistance. This material choice is crucial when working with tough surfaces like concrete, as it ensures that the bit remains sharp and effective over multiple uses. The precision ground carbide tip is designed to reduce walking, which means you can start drilling with greater accuracy and less effort. This is particularly useful when working on projects that require precise hole placement.

The bit also incorporates a 1/4" hex shoulder, making it compatible with both hammer drills and impact drivers. This versatility is a significant advantage, especially for those who already own various types of drills. The hex shoulder ensures a secure fit, reducing the likelihood of slippage during operation. Additionally, the wide flute design is engineered for effective dust removal, which helps maintain a clean work area and improves the efficiency of the drilling process.
